  14. // "liveMedia"
  15. // Copyright (c) 1996-2019 Live Networks, Inc. All rights reserved.
  16. // RTP sink for AMR audio (RFC 4867)
  17. // C++ header
  18. #ifndef _AMR_AUDIO_RTP_SINK_HH
  19. #define _AMR_AUDIO_RTP_SINK_HH
  20. #ifndef _AUDIO_RTP_SINK_HH
  21. #include "AudioRTPSink.hh"
  22. #endif
  23. class AMRAudioRTPSink: public AudioRTPSink {
  24. public:
  25. static AMRAudioRTPSink* createNew(UsageEnvironment& env,
  26. Groupsock* RTPgs,
  27. unsigned char rtpPayloadFormat,
  28. Boolean sourceIsWideband = False,
  29. unsigned numChannelsInSource = 1);
  30. Boolean sourceIsWideband() const { return fSourceIsWideband; }
  31. protected:
  32. AMRAudioRTPSink(UsageEnvironment& env, Groupsock* RTPgs,
  33. unsigned char rtpPayloadFormat,
  34. Boolean sourceIsWideband, unsigned numChannelsInSource);
  35. // called only by createNew()
  36. virtual ~AMRAudioRTPSink();
  37. private: // redefined virtual functions:
  38. virtual Boolean sourceIsCompatibleWithUs(MediaSource& source);
  39. virtual void doSpecialFrameHandling(unsigned fragmentationOffset,
  40. unsigned char* frameStart,
  41. unsigned numBytesInFrame,
  42. struct timeval framePresentationTime,
  43. unsigned numRemainingBytes);
  44. virtual Boolean
  45. frameCanAppearAfterPacketStart(unsigned char const* frameStart,
  46. unsigned numBytesInFrame) const;
  47. virtual unsigned specialHeaderSize() const;
  48. virtual char const* auxSDPLine();
  49. private:
  50. Boolean fSourceIsWideband;
  51. char* fFmtpSDPLine;
  52. };
  53. #endif
